Chanel Performance Analysis Assistant — Ready-to-Wear Press
Chanel is an iconic French luxury fashion house known for haute couture, ready-to-wear, accessories, fragrance and beauty. As an employer, Chanel combines deep artisanal savoir‑faire with rigorous commercial and corporate functions across global markets, offering a fast‑paced, detail‑driven environment that values creativity, discretion and excellence.
- Support the Press department of Ready‑to‑Wear by collecting, consolidating and analysing media coverage and PR campaign performance across print, online and social channels.
- Prepare regular dashboards and ad‑hoc reports that track reach, impressions, share of voice, sentiment and key KPIs for collections and launches.
- Maintain and enrich media and influencer databases; tag and categorise coverage for accurate trend analysis.
- Collaborate with PR, communications and marketing teams to translate insights into actionable recommendations for media strategy and pitching.
- Assist in monitoring competitor activity and benchmarking press performance against identified peers.
- Contribute to presentation materials for internal stakeholders, ensuring clarity, visual coherence and data accuracy.
